Sizuk performs opening theme “Cotton Days” for January 2024 anime
The legit net space for the anime of Yuriko Takagami‘s Fluffy Paradise manga revealed a contemporary visual and the opening theme song files for the anime on Friday. (The manga is itself an adaptation of Himawari and Kirouran‘s Isekai de Mofumofu Nadenade Suru Tameni Ganbattemasu — actually, I will Strive My Finest So I Can Pet and Pat in One other World — light recent series.)

Sizuk, the song mission of composer Shunryū, is contributing the anime’s opening theme song “Cotton Days.”

The anime will premiere in January 2024. Crunchyroll will scramble the anime in January 2024.
Ai Kakuma will megastar within the series as Néma.
Jun’ichi Kitamura (episode director on Kuma Kuma Kuma Dangle, My Spouse is the Student Council President) is directing the anime at EMT Squared, Deko Akao (After the Rain, Noragami) is in trace of the series scripts, and Asami Miyazaki (key animation on Inazuma Eleven, animation director on Major 2nd, Kaiketsu Zorori) is designing the characters.
Takagami launched the manga adaptation of the novels on Futabasha‘s Gaugau Monster net space and app in 2017. Coolmic is publishing the manga in English digitally below the title Fluffy Paradise. The corporate describes the series:
Midori Akitsu (27 years extinct), finally ends up in another world after death from overwork?! I obtained reincarnated in another world after God blessed me with a diversified skill. This skill is “to be cherished by non-human beings.” Huh?! Which implies that humans may maybe maybe no longer love me, but all of the fluffy animals will like me? Whoaaa! I receive to pet a white tiger and dragons to my coronary heart’s [content]! After being reborn as Néma, the youngest daughter of a top class noble family, I’m doing my finest for the survival of humanity (?) while playing this world’s fluffiness.
Himawari launched the unconventional series on the Shōsetsuka ni Narō net space in 2012, and the series is ongoing. Rotten Infinite World is releasing the novels in English.
